Notice of the Meeting of
the Commissioners Court of Bell County, Texas, for
August 20, 2001
Notice is hereby given that a
regular meeting of the
above named Court will be held at nine a.m. August 20, 2001, with the
meeting to be held in the Commissioners' Courtroom, at the Bell
County Courthouse 101 Central Avenue, Belton, Texas, to
begin on August 20, 2001, at 9:00 a.m.
and continue thereafter until such business of the Court has been completed in accordance
with Article 81.005 of the Local Government Code of the State of Texas. The
following items of business will be discussed, to-wit:
Minutes of previous
meetings. (August 13, 2001).
County Engineer
Conduct public
hearing and consider approval for the installation of the following
traffic control devices: 1) Install a 55 mph speed limit on Bottoms
East, from IH 35 to Bigham Road; 2) Install a 30 mph speed limit on
Quail Run, Pecan Creek Subdivision; 3) Install a YIELD sign on
Donahoe Road at Vilas Road (north-bound traffic).

In accordance with
Section 111.007 the Court will hold a public hearing on the proposed budget
for all departments of Bell County, Texas; discuss the proposed tax
rate for FY 2001-02 and announce time and date which the Court will set the
tax rate to cover the proposed FY 2001-02 budget. Any taxpayer of the
County may attend and may participate in the hearing.
